Regtech House Makes C-Suite, Other Appointments

One of the senior figures joining CUBE is the chief executive of Chelsea Football Club.

CUBE, a UK regulatory technology firm partnering with private equity house Hg Capital, has made a number of C-suite hires.

Chris Jurasek is joining as non-executive chairman; he is CEO of Chelsea Football Club and brings over 25 years' experience of working with leading global tech and data companies.

Emma Brown, whom the firm called an “experienced tech finance professional and diversity champion,” will join as the new chief financial officer in September. 

Stéphane Besson, who is continuing as non-executive director, has been involved in supporting CUBE’s acquisitions to date in 2024.

The business provides AI-driven regulatory data to power its Automated Regulatory Intelligence (ARI) and Regulatory Change Management (RCM) solutions. It operates in Europe, North America, Canada, Asia, and Australia. The firm partnered with Hg Capital in March this year. It also bought US-based Reg-Room and the Thomson Reuters Regulatory Intelligence and Oden products and businesses in May 2024.
